3-year-old rescued from “lola” kidnapper

This one does not want to have a lonely Valentine’s.

A 53-year-old woman, said to be abandoned by her lover, abducted a 3-year-old girl from Quezon City and held her captive until her ex returns to her.

The child was rescued at a bus terminal in Quezon City by operatives of the Criminal Investigation and Detection Group (CIDG) over the weekend. CIDG Chief Samuel Pagdilao identified the suspect as Baby Nelda Diwa, 53, a resident of Nagkaisang Nayon, Novaliches, Q.C.

The child was a relative of her former lover, Albert Talamo. It was Talamo who ended the relationship and Diwa abducted the child and held her hostage. She even threatened to kill the girl if Talamo does not come back to her, the Journal reported.
